The Rise of MMC House Extensions
MMC house extensions represent a significant leap forward in residential architecture. By utilizing advanced CAD software and robotic assembly, manufacturers achieve tolerances that are impossible with manual on-site builds.
These structures are often 80% complete before they even reach your garden. This includes internal finishes, plumbing, and electrical wiring already integrated into the modules.
The Benefits of Prefabricated Timber Frames
One of the most popular materials in the current market is prefabricated timber frames. Timber is a naturally renewable resource that acts as a carbon sink, aligning perfectly with Net Zero goals.
Modern timber frames are treated for extreme durability and fire resistance. They provide excellent natural insulation, helping you maintain a comfortable indoor climate year-round.
* Rapid Installation: Most timber frames can be erected in just a few days.
* Sustainability: Low embodied carbon compared to steel or concrete.
* Precision: Computer-controlled cutting ensures a perfect fit every time.
* Versatility: Ideal for various architectural styles from London to the Cotswolds.

Understanding Modular Extension Costs UK
Navigating modular extension costs UK requires an understanding of the total value proposition. While the initial price point may seem comparable to traditional builds, the savings in time and labour are substantial.
In 2026, the average cost for a high-specification modular extension ranges from £2,500 to £3,500 per square metre. This includes design, manufacture, delivery, and final on-site assembly.
Factors Influencing Your Budget
* Site Accessibility: Narrow access in urban areas like London may require specialist crane hire.
* Internal Specification: High-end finishes and bespoke kitchen units will increase the total investment.
* Foundation Requirements: Modern helical screw piles are often faster and cheaper than traditional strip foundations.
* Utility Connections: Extending water, gas, and electricity from the main house to the new module.
The Process: From Factory to Foundations
The journey of Modular House Extensions UK begins long before the first module arrives. A comprehensive design phase ensures that the new structure complements your existing home perfectly.
Once the design is finalised, the manufacturing process begins in a climate-controlled facility. This removes the risk of weather-related delays which frequently plague traditional UK building sites.
Step-by-Step Modular Timeline
* Week 1-4: Architectural design and securing planning permission or Permitted Development rights.
* Week 5-8: Off-site fabrication of the modular units and prefabricated timber frames.
* Week 9: Groundworks and foundation preparation at your property.
* Week 10: Delivery and craning of the modules onto the foundations.
* Week 11-12: Final utility connections, external cladding, and internal snagging.

Regulatory Compliance and Building Control
Modular House Extensions UK must comply with the 2026 updates to Part L and Part O of the Building Regulations. These focus on fuel and power conservation and preventing overheating.
Because modular units are built in a factory, they undergo rigorous quality checks at every stage. This often makes the final Building Control sign-off much faster than traditional builds.
Key 2026 Regulatory Considerations
* Ventilation: Mechanical Ventilation with Heat Recovery (MVHR) is now standard in airtight modular builds.
* Thermal Bridging: Advanced detailing ensures no heat escapes through structural joints.
* Fire Safety: Enhanced cladding regulations ensure all materials are non-combustible or fire-retardant.
